Definitions:

Debt-To-Equity Ratio

It's a financial indicator that compares the proportions of debt and shareholders' equity in funding company assets.

Total Assets

The aggregate of current and fixed assets held by a corporation.

Total Liabilities

The total amount of financial obligations or debts that a company owes to external parties.

Return On Equity

A financial ratio that measures the profitability of a company in relation to the shareholders' equity, indicating how efficiently a company uses its equity to generate profit.
